The Power of Magnetic Simplicity

The Starlink Mini Magnetic Mount stands out in the crowded field of satellite internet accessories through its ingenious magnetic attachment system. Unlike traditional mounts that require drilling, bolting, or permanent modifications to your vehicle, this mount uses powerful rare-earth magnets to securely attach your Starlink Mini dish to any ferrous metal surface. This means you can set up high-speed internet connectivity in minutes, not hours, making it perfect for the spontaneous adventures that define the Australian travel experience.

The magnetic base features multiple high-strength neodymium magnets strategically positioned to provide exceptional holding power while distributing the load evenly across the mounting surface. This design ensures your Starlink dish remains securely in place even when traversing Australia's notoriously rough outback roads or dealing with strong coastal winds.

Built for Australian Conditions

Australia's diverse climate presents unique challenges for outdoor equipment, and the Starlink Mini Magnetic Mount rises to meet them all. Constructed from marine-grade materials with weather-resistant coatings, this mount withstands everything from the scorching heat of the Red Centre to the salt spray of coastal highways. The corrosion-resistant finish ensures longevity even in harsh environments, making it a reliable companion for extended road trips across the continent.

The mount's low-profile design minimizes wind resistance, crucial when travelling at highway speeds between destinations. This aerodynamic consideration not only improves fuel efficiency but also reduces wind noise and stress on both the mount and your vehicle's roof.

Versatility That Matches Your Lifestyle

One of the most compelling features of the Starlink Mini Magnetic Mount is its incredible versatility. The magnetic base adheres securely to various surfaces including:

  • Vehicle roofs: Perfect for caravans, motorhomes, 4WDs, and utes
  • Shipping containers: Ideal for remote work sites and temporary offices
  • Steel structures: Excellent for construction sites and industrial applications
  • Boat surfaces: Great for marine applications (with appropriate marine-grade considerations)

This versatility makes it an invaluable tool for tradespeople who move between different work environments. Electricians working on remote solar farms, miners at fly-in-fly-out operations, and construction workers on infrastructure projects can all benefit from reliable internet connectivity wherever their work takes them.
